magnum/magnum/drivers/k8s_fedora_atomic_v1
Diogo Guerra ea64468ab3 3. Configure monitoring apps path based endpoints
* Add monitoring_ingress_enabled magnum label to set up ingress with
path based routing for all the configured services
{alertmanager,grafana,prometheus}. When using this,
cluster_root_domain_name magnum label must be used to setup base path
where this services are available.
* Add cluster_basic_auth_secret magnum label to configure basic auth
on unprotected services {alertmanager and  prometheus}. This is only
in effect when app access is routed by ingress.
* Set services logFormat to json to enable easier machine log parsing.

task: 39477
story: 2006765

Depends-On: Ieb90605182626869528349a7fdeed65061914bcb
Change-Id: Ie0e7000e0d94b2037f2c398fa67a2a2b7e256bc3
Signed-off-by: Diogo Guerra <diogo.filipe.tomas.guerra@cern.ch>
2021-02-05 15:52:52 +00:00
..
templates 3. Configure monitoring apps path based endpoints 2021-02-05 15:52:52 +00:00
tools [k8s] Monitoring with Prometheus and Grafana 2017-03-17 11:41:43 +01:00
__init__.py Bay driver: k8s Fedora Atomic 2016-07-11 10:50:06 -05:00
driver.py Support Fedora CoreOS 30 2019-10-16 09:44:19 +00:00
template_def.py Refactor driver interface (pt 1) 2016-12-01 09:23:46 -06:00
version.py Upgrade to Fedora 25 2017-01-26 15:40:34 +01:00